With a full house this year, I had to do some major reorganizing and rid the classroom of clutter.  Here are some of my new ideas:

Table numbers are hanging from the ceiling, instead of being in the middle of each table!

All the things that make up the Listening Center have been relocated to the Reading Pond. I love my new storage closet!

Students’ Journals and Thematic Notebooks will be placed in the magazine holders that are color coordinated to each table group!

A new job chart gives each student an opportunity to have a different job each week.
